Scums generic bounty hunter could be a sleeper ship none is really talking about. Boba Fett/Han/Marauder is getting all the hype (and for good reason) but switching out Boba for a generic Bounty Hunter lets you upgrade one fangfighter to Fenn.

Squadron#1 gives opponents a difficult choice for target priority. Use Fenn as a flanker with BH as a blocker/brawler in close. Palob chips in supporting damage and messes with their actions.

Squadron#2 I just like Palob in general but you could use a second fangfighter instead if you like and go BH/Fenn/Skull Sqdrn Pilot.

Squadron#3 Torkil Mux backing up BH is pretty nasty and will give you opportunities to take out most small ships before they get to fire back.

I think the key with all these lists is to keep the BH alive for a long as possible, since you want him to be the primary target. Getting Fenn in multiple arcs early will be his demise, so he had to be very careful on his approach. Palob can help with that too an extend.

However I am not sure if you need 0-0-0 on the BH. I'd like the more defensive approach with debris gambit, but sadly the BH has lost his talent.

Han gunner... I am not sold. You will get the focus at initiative 2, which is very late. With Han gunner I'd want to shoot very early, to have the focus for defense if needed. This is why it is so strong on Boba - initiative 5

The BH is more likely to get the Calculate token than the targeted ship get a stress. The maneuverability reduction and possible loss of action that close to a Marauder? No thanks (4 dice with reroll and possibly focus on Marauder Firesprays hurts).

Just needs to get close enough to 3 Tallon or 4K someone into arc then blue slow boat + reinforce rear until they end up range 1. If the target over shoots and ends up front arc it is still 4 dice. Getting the rear arc set up isn't hard. :)
